چکیده مقاله:

Introduction: Breast cancer is one of the most common malignant diseases and the second cause of death among women in the world, and according to statistics, one in every 12 people suffers from breast cancer. Iranian patients with breast cancer are younger than their Western counterparts. Plant-based drugs are promising therapeutic agents against cancers. Cordia myxa is a plant of Boraginaceae family, widely cultivated in Iran. Thus, we assessed the effects of Cordia myxa extract on breast cancer cell line and the expression level of both caspase-3 gene and proteins.Methods: In this experimental study, the MCF-7cell line was selected for treatment with the various concentrations of Cordia myxa hydro-alcoholic extract. Cell proliferation was evaluated using MTT-method. Additionally, the impact of the Cordia myxa extract on the expression level of caspase-3 gene were examined using quantitative real-time polymerase chain reaction (qRT-PCR). Finally, the levels of caspase-3 protein have been evaluated with western bolt method.Results: Cell proliferation studies represented anticancer characteristics of dose-dependent of the hydro-alcoholic extract of Cordia myxa. Furthermore, Cordia myxa hydro-alcoholic extract led to increase expression of caspase-3.Conclusion: In overall, Cordia myxa can be a proper choice for designing anticancer drugs as a potential candidate for major investigations on breast cancer. This plant could have a possible application for cancer treatment as another anti-cancer agent, as well as drug poisoning.
